The City of Kathmandu is actually made up of the three ancient cities of Kathmandu, Patan and Bhaktapur who’s historic centres still exist hidden amongst the hustle and bustle of todays metropolis. Kathmandu has long been the focal point of Nepal, containing both Hindu and Buddhist sites that date back over two thousand years of of which seven are listed as World Heritage Sites. Kathmandu is an energetic, rich cultural hub with unique architecture, stunning temples and vibrant festivals and markets that keeps tourists returning to Nepal.

Bhaktapur Tour

Bhaktapur city is situated about 20 km east of downtown Kathmandu and is one of the three royal cities of the Kathmandu Valley and is famous for it’s art, culture and festivals. This city is filled with monuments, elaborate temples, shrines, palaces, pagodas and many other cultural and religious monuments. The ancient trades of wood carving, handmade papers, pottery and cloth weaving are also attractions of Bhaktapur where many of these traditional activities are still performed as they have for centuries before. A visit to Bhaktapur is a fascinating and beautiful view into the traditional culture and history of Nepal.

Patan Tour 

Patan is a protected UNESCO World Heritage site and was the capital of its own kingdom from the 6th to 17th centuries. Patan is often referred to as Lalitpur, which means city of beauty. Patan’s central square is absolutely packed with temples and is an architectural feast with a far greater concentration of temples than anywhere else in Nepal. Patan has a long Buddhist history with numerous monasteries and the four corners of the city are marked by stupas. Patan also offers you an insight into the Newari people and culture and has the most extensive display of beautiful Newari architecture to be seen in Nepal.
